Skype 4.1 for Windows goes live

Available for download now


1 July 2009 12:06 GMT / By Duncan Geere

A little over a month after entering beta, Skype 4.1 has gone gold and is now available. You can get it right now from the Skype website.

As previously reported on Pocket-lint, the new version includes screen sharing between Windows, Mac and Linux, as well as birthday reminders and the ability to send contacts to other Skype users.

The company's also promising better video and call quality, and various accessibility features. If that sounds like your cup of tea, then head over to the Skype website to download it.
